Journey to Fes
After a traditional breakfast, the group journeys to Fes, Morocco’s spiritual and artistic heart. Upon arrival, plunge into the Old Medina, a UNESCO World Heritage site famed for its maze-like alleys and vibrant souks. Here, creativity isn’t just seen — it’s smelled and heard, especially at the historic tanneries. These ancient “Dar Dbagh” have shaped Fes’s identity for centuries, their honeycomb vats bursting with earthy and jewel-toned dyes, and their techniques passed down through generations. Witness artisans at work, transforming raw hides into the world’s finest leather — a true testament to Moroccan craftsmanship.

Tangier: Legends and light on the edge of Africa
After breakfast, the journey continues north to the storied city of Tangier. Begin your exploration by gazing out from Cape Spartel, where the Atlantic meets the Mediterranean in a dramatic clash of waves and wind. Delve into the mythic Hercules Cave, a place steeped in legend — said to be where Hercules rested after parting the continents, and inhabited by Neolithic people thousands of years ago. The Old Medina of Tangier, with its whitewashed walls and bohemian flair, has inspired generations of artists and writers.
Absorb the creative energy before enjoying a free evening to explore Tangier’s vibrant nightlife or seaside promenades.
50 shades of blue in Chefchaouen
Today’s excursion takes you to Chefchaouen, the famed “Blue Pearl” of Morocco nestled in the Rif Mountains. The medina’s blue-washed walls — rooted in Jewish tradition and practical wisdom — create a dreamlike atmosphere that feels both tranquil and surreal. Wander through narrow lanes adorned with vibrant doors and potted plants, browse local markets for handmade crafts, and take in panoramic views of the mountains. The city’s blend of Berber, Andalusian, and Jewish influences makes it a living work of art, perfect for painters, photographers, and dreamers alike.
